Periplus Kemang Closure
At mid day today Periplus Books gave Merdeka Coffee 7 days notice to take over management of the Café at Periplus, Hero Kemang. The reason given was vaguely linked to a “conflict of interest” with the recently opened Kemang Villa Café- which was in fact in part set up to help service the busy Periplus Cafe
Subsequently our last day of trading at Periplus will be on Tuesday 13th May, 2008. As yet we do not have a new premises to move to, but will work hard on this over the next month.
As of tomorrow (8th May, 2008) Coffee packs will not be available from Periplus, but can be purchased as normal from Jakarta's Kemang Club Villa’s café (the clubhouse by the swimming pool).
We will have no involvement whatsoever with Periplus from the end of trading on the 13th of May. Merdeka Coffee will not be available from any of the Periplus outlets nationwide.
